Entry requirements

Entry requirements set by ASQA are the basic qualifications and criteria that students must meet before enrolling in a nationally recognised course.

These requirements ensure students have the skills and knowledge needed to undertake this course.

  • There are no formal academic requirements
  • Additional entry requirements are set by individual course providers

If you're considering a career in the mining and field exploration industry, the Certificate II in Mining/Field Exploration offered in Bacchus Marsh is an excellent stepping stone. This course equips you with foundational skills and knowledge necessary to embark on a rewarding career. Graduates can pursue diverse opportunities such as a General Labourer, Surveyor Assistant, or even a Driller Offsider. These roles are critical in the field, making you a valuable asset to any mining operation.

The training is facilitated by reputable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) recognised within the industry, ensuring that you receive quality education and hands-on experience. This course connects with broader fields of study including Building and Construction, Engineering, and Environment and Sustainability, allowing you to explore various career paths.
